COMMONWEALTH OF AUSTRALIA

 

Sections 226 and 708

Offshore Petroleum and Greenhouse Gas Storage Act 2006

 

APPLICATION FOR VARIATION OF A PIPELINE LICENCE –

PIPELINE LICENCE VIC/PL25 (7GGBDT)

 

I, STEVEN ROBERT TAYLOR, Delegate of the National Offshore Petroleum Titles Administrator, on behalf of the Commonwealth–Victoria Offshore Petroleum Joint Authority hereby give notice pursuant to sections 226 and 708 of the Offshore Petroleum and Greenhouse Gas Storage Act 2006 (the Act) that an application has been received from

 

Esso Australia Resources Pty Ltd

(ACN 091 829 819)

 

Woodside Energy (Bass Strait) Pty Ltd

(ACN 004 228 004)

 

for the variation of Pipeline Licence VIC/PL25 in the offshore area of Victoria, as set out below.

 

Pursuant to subsection 226(3) of the Act, a person may make a written submission to the Titles Administrator about this application within 30 days from the date of this notice.

 

This notice takes effect on the day on which it appears in the
Australian Government Gazette.

2.      The SECOND SCHEDULE of the Licence is varied by:

 

  1. deleting the following text under the first paragraph of item (i), Part B – Materials of Construction – Steel Pipe:

 

and except for the riser pipework

 

b.      deleting the following text under the second and third paragraphs in item (i), Part B –Materials of Construction – Steel Pipe:

 

The said riser paperwork shall be API Spec. 5LX, Grade X6-0 seamless pipe and have the dimensions 219.1 mm O.D. and 18.3 mm W.T.

 

The connection of the said riser pipework to the line pipe shall be made by flexible jumpers as detailed in the specifications accompanying the original pipeline licence application. The flexible jumpers are fabricated from composite material manufactured by Coflexip and have a Nylon-11 pressure containing sheath.

 

 

 

 

c.       deleting the following text under item (ii), Part B – Protective Coating:

 

Protection of the riser pipework by an epoxy coating shall be in accordance with the Coating Specification No 4.3 – Protective Coatings for Onshore Plants, Offshore Platforms and other Marine Structures.

 

In accordance with Esso specifications, the section of riser that is above the caisson is coated with CBS inorganic.

 

In the splash zones, the risers are wrapped in a 10 mm carbon steel sleeve and a 4.75 mm Monel sheath.

 

d.      deleting the text under Part C – Cathodic Protection:

 

(a)   Insulating flanges and gaskets shall be maintained on the pipeline in accordance with the Construction Specifications accompanying the original pipeline licence application.

 

(b)   Transformer rectifier units on the Whiting platform and the Snapper platform shall provide protection to the subsea portion of the pipeline.

 

(c)   Sacrificial anodes in the form of zinc bracelets shall be installed as detailed in the construction specifications and cathodic protection design.

 

The rest of the SECOND SCHEDULE remains as stated in the licence instrument dated 31 August 1989 and as varied on 6 October 2020.
